Hejaz, Saudi Arabia

Mobile & Internet

Local SIM cards from STC, Mobily, Zain are available at the airport or malls. Passport registration applies. Wi-Fi is widely found in hotels, cafes, malls. Fast 4G/5G mobile data covers major cities.

Language & Translation

Arabic is the official language. English is common in business, tourism, and major centers. Road signs are bilingual.

Important Phrases

Common Greetings

  • Hello: Marhaba (مرحبا)
  • Thank you: Shukran (شكراً)
  • Yes/No: Na'am/La (نعم/لا)
  • Please: Min fadlik (f) / Min fadlak (m) (من فضلك)

Useful Expressions

  • Excuse me/Sorry: Afwan (عفواً)
  • How much? Kam hatha? (كم هذا؟)
  • Water: Ma'a (ماء)
  • Delicious: Ladheedh (لذيذ)

Business Hours

Operating hours in Jeddah vary by business type and holidays.

Government Offices

Sunday to Thursday, 7:30 AM - 2:30 PM.

Shopping Malls

Generally daily from 10:00 AM until 11:00 PM or midnight.

Souks

Often morning (9:00 AM - 1:00 PM) and evening (4:00 PM - 10:00 PM) shifts.

Banking & ATMs

Banks: Generally open Sunday to Thursday, from 9:00 AM to 4:30 PM. ATMs are widely available at banks, malls, supermarkets, accepting international cards.

Public Holidays

The official weekend in Saudi Arabia is Friday and Saturday. Major holidays include Eid al-Fitr, Eid al-Adha, Saudi National Day (September 23), and Founding Day (February 22).

Seasonal Adjustments

Summer Period

  • Reduced outdoor attraction hours.
  • Focus on indoor activities.
  • Some shops might close mid-day.

Ramadan Period

  • Reduced business hours.
  • Restaurants open after sunset.
  • Shops stay open late.

Etiquette & Customs

Saudi society holds conservative values that shape public behavior.

Greeting Practices

Handshakes are common between men. Women do not initiate physical contact with Saudi men unless offered. "Assalamu Alaikum" is a well-received greeting.

Attire & Dining

Adhere to modesty guidelines for dress. Use your right hand for traditional foods. Tipping is generally welcomed.

Photography Guidelines

Always ask for permission before photographing individuals, notably women and children. Avoid government or military buildings.

Sensitive Topics

Alcohol and pork are prohibited. Avoid public displays of affection. Public LGBTQ+ expression is not tolerated.

Dress Code

  • Strict modesty applies for all.
  • Women's hair covering is needed for mosques.
  • Remove shoes before entering prayer halls.

Accessibility in Jeddah

Jeddah's infrastructure for travelers with mobility challenges is improving, especially in newer developments.

Infrastructure Developments

Modern shopping malls, luxury hotels, King Abdulaziz International Airport, and the Haramain High-Speed Railway feature accessibility.

Transport & Attractions

Major modern attractions like the Corniche and King Fahd's Fountain are accessible. Ride-sharing apps offer some accessible vehicle options.
